Maldives Transport and Contracting Company (MTCC) on Thursday signed an agreement with the Ministry of National Planning, Housing, and Infrastructure towards implementation of N. Velidhoo Picnic Island Project.

MTCC CEO Adam Azim signed on behalf of MTCC while Fathimath Shaana Farooq, DG, signed on behalf of Ministry.

MP Mohamed Abdulla Shafeeg was also present at the ceremony.

The scope of works include, 61,200 cbm reclamation operations, 50m groyne and 412m geobag revetment. The value of the project is MVR 19.16 million.

In addition to this, MTCC has also been awarded the project to develop a junior college in the island.

Adam Azim signed on behalf of MTCC and Minister Dr. Ibrahim Hassan signed on behalf of Ministry.

According to MTCC, the scope of works include, 2 classrooms, 1 ICT lab, 1 library, 2 workshops in an area of 10,276 sqft.

The value of the project is MVR 11.91 million.
